After signing up, you can change the shape placement, text content, and more. There is only one process in the system and all the data flows either into or out of this. Draw the context diagram first, followed by various layers of data flow diagrams. The first level dfd shows the main processes within the system. The garment management receives the order and distributes the work to its employees. Railway reservation level 1 editable data flow diagram. The dfd also provides information about the outputs and inputs of each entity and the process itself. Its designed to be an abstraction view, showing the system as a single process with its relationship to external entities. A dataflow diagram dfd is a way of representing a flow of a data of a process or a system usually an information system. Please subscribe my channel for getting first updates after uploading video. Similarly, processes in the second level dfd 2 are numbered eg 1.
Here, we will see mainly 3 levels in data flow diagram, which are. Do not worry about which parts of what system this diagram is describing look at the diagram to get a feel for the symbols and notation of a dataflow diagram. At this level, there is only one visible process node that represents the functions of a complete system in. A data flow diagram that represents a systems major processes, data flows, and data stores at a high level of detail.
You can edit this dfd level 1 template with a free lucidchart account. The system is fully webbased and connects the general public with the data bases containing driving licenses, driving records, and vehicle title and. It is usually beginning with a context diagram as level 0 of the dfd diagram, a simple. Each of these processes can be broken into further processes until you reach pseudo code. Jan 02, 2018 please subscribe my channel for getting first updates after uploading video. Hospital management system dataflow diagram dfd freeprojectz. Below context level data flow diagram of student management system project shows the one admin user can operate the system.
Teoritucaly, dfd could go even beyond level 3, but they rarely do this on practice. Dfds can also be used for the visualization of data processing structured design and show what kind of. Umldfd methods utilize that data flow diagram which is being called process diagram in the twohemisphere modeldriven approach in order to represent the business process. Draw the dfds upto 2nd level for online examination system. First level data flow diagram 1st level dfd of library management system. Context data flow diagram example in pdf with an explanation step by step. An overview of an organizational system that shows the system boundaries, external entities that interact with the system and the major information flows between the entities and the system. Dfd levels are numbered 0, 1 or 2, and occasionally go to even level 3 or beyond. The context level data flow diagram dfd is describe the whole system.
Apr 18, 2017 first level data flow diagram1st level dfd of online pizza ordering system. Data flow diagram dfd with full example hindi easy way. Aug 03, 2019 first level dfd 1st level of airlines reservation system shows how the system is divided into subsystems processeseach of which deals with one or more of the data flows to or from an external agent, and which together provide all of the functionality of the airlines reservation system system as a whole. Firstly i will look at context level dfds and give an example. The number of levels depends on the size of the model system. This is a level 1 data flow diagram for gym management system. The dataflow diagram is a modeling tool that allows us to picture a system as a network of. In level 0 dfd diagram, it will display the menus of the project that is. A level 1 dfd notates each of the main subprocesses that together form the complete system. First level dfd 1st level of online pizza ordering system shows how the system is divided into subsystems processes, each of which deals with one or more of the data flows to or from an external agent, and which together provide all of the functionality of the online pizza ordering system system as a whole. Level 1 dfd also mentions basic processes and sources of information. You can edit this template and create your own diagram. We can think of a level 1 dfd as an exploded view of the context diagram.
Slideshare uses cookies to improve functionality and performance, and to provide you with relevant advertising. The logical dfd consists of 5 main processes like order. Often it is a preliminary step used to create an overview of the system that can later be elaborated. It is usually beginning with a context diagram as level 0 of the dfd diagram, a simple representation of the whole system. Data flows draw a level 0 data flow diagram dfd that fits the following system. Level 1 diagrams may not be needed for all level 0. The system is fully webbased and connects the general public with the data bases containing driving licenses, driving records, and vehicle title and registrations. From the level one it shows the publishers present ordering system.
Level 0 dfd for library management system checkykey. Enter context as diagram name and click ok to confirm. First level data flow diagram1st level dfd of online pizza ordering system. A data flow diagram dfd is a graphical representation of the flow of data through an information system as shown on the dfd flow chart figure 5, modeling its process aspects. First level dfd 1st level of airlines reservation system shows how the system is divided into subsystems processeseach of which deals with one or more of the data flows to or from an external agent, and which together provide all of the functionality. Level 0 dfd is known as context diagram a context diagram is a data flow diagram that only shows the top level, otherwise known as level 0. Data flow diagram tutorial objectives after completion of study of. To elaborate further from that, we drill down to a level 1 diagram with lower. First level data flow diagram1st level dfd of hospital management system. Data flow diagrams solution extends conceptdraw pro software with templates, samples and libraries of vector stencils for drawing the data flow diagrams dfd.
A single process node on a high level diagram can be expanded to show a more detailed data flow diagram. A data flow diagram dfd is a graphical representation of the flow of data through an. First level dfd 1st level of library management system shows how the system is divided into subsystems processes, each of which deals with one or more of the data flows to or from an external agent, and which together provide all of the functionality of the library management system system as a whole. A suggested context diagram and a level0 diagram are provided below.
How can i draw a data flow diagram and a context diagram for class a website level 0, level 1. Level 1 dfd depicts basic modules in the system and flow of data among various modules. It provides a more detailed view of the context level diagram. First level dfd 1st level of airlines reservation system shows how the system is divided into subsystems processeseach of which deals with one or more of the data flows to or from an external agent, and which together provide all of the functionality of the airlines reservation system system as a whole. An example of part of a dataflow diagram is given below. Context level dfd for fin corp cash controller 1st level dfds dfd for new bank creation dfd for new branch creation 2nd level. In the new diagram window, select data flow diagram and click next. From the diagram toolbar, drag process onto the diagram. It aims to show how the entire system works at a glance. Decompose this diagram until it doesnt make sense to continue. Level 1 dataflow diagrams level 1 dfds present a more detailed view of the system than context diagrams, by showing the main subprocesses and stores. Explain the differences between dfd and erd with examples. Emphasize form the beginning of this discussion about dfds, that they are intended primarily as a communication tool within is and not as a documentation tool.
Dfd example general model of publishers present ordering. As described previously, context diagrams level 0 dfds are diagrams where the whole system is represented as a single process. Then i will look at level 1 dfds and give an example. Dfds were first used in the software engineering field as a notation. View and share this diagram and more in your device or. A level 1 data flow diagram dfd is more detailed than a level 0 dfd but not as detailed as a level 2 dfd. Pdf comparative study on dfd to uml diagrams transformations. Data flow diagram tutorial after completion of study of this.
The toplevel dfd consists of only one bubble, representing the entire system. Online shopping project dfd data flow diagram for students. Choose an example like that in problem and exercise 2, and draw a context diagram. Dfd represents the data flow diagram, which shows the flow of a series of data based on a certain information system model. An example dataflow diagram as can be seen, the dfd notation consists of only four main symbols.
A data flow diagram can dive into progressively more detail by using levels and layers, zeroing in on a particular piece. Draw data flow diagrams can be made in several nested layers. First level dfd event management system project pdf. Imtiajur rahman 1 data flow diagram level0 to level1 2. User can first select product for buy, user must have to register in our system for purchase any item from our website. Diagram 0 is a dfd that that shows the first level of detail below the initial context diagram and shows major processes, data flows and data stores while repeating the external entities and data flows that show up in the context diagram. Each time a process is expanded to a lower level, the lower level diagram must show all the same dataflows into, and out of the higher level process it expands. The below context level 0 th level diagram for shopping cart system explains about. A data flow diagram that represents a systems major. A data flow diagram showing railway reservation level 1.
First, incoming orders are checked for correct book titles, authors names, and other information and then batched into other. Online pizza ordering system dataflow diagram dfd freeprojectz. Imtiajur rahman 1 data flow diagram level 0 to level 1 2. Apr 05, 2019 firstly i will look at context level dfds and give an example. This kind of diagram is a first step in understanding what information is in the system and how it is used to perform the required functions. A data flow diagram dfd represents graphically a flow of data within a system.
Online shopping project dfd data flow diagrams projects. Creating the database and other supporting structures based on a specific dbms conceptual design. Creately diagrams can be exported and added to word, ppt powerpoint, excel, visio or any other document. Draw 3 levels of dfd for library management systems dfd library management system 1st level zero level dfd of college library management systems read more on data flow diagram symbols. The 0 level dfd known as context level data flow diagram. It breaks down the main processes into subprocesses that can then be analyzed and improved on a more intimate level. Secretary of state web site development project you have been tasked with developing the software for the michigan secretary of state. Draw dfd data flow diagram to 2nd level for online. Sep 04, 2016 level 0 dfd is known as context diagram a context diagram is a data flow diagram that only shows the top level, otherwise known as level 0. A context diagram is a top level view of a system that displays the boundaries and scope of the system. In the next, the socalled first level dfd 1 the numbering continues. In addition to the context and level 1 data flow diagram, there are also level 2 and level 3 dfd.
Data flow diagram dfd can provide each of these in a broadbased first cut. First level dfd 1st level of hospital management system shows how the system is divided into subsystems processes, each of which deals with one or more of the data flows to or from an external agent, and which together provide all of the functionality of the hospital management system system as a whole. This article will explain the differences between dfd and erd with examples, but first, let us check out the basic definitions of these two models. Constructing level 1 dfds if no context diagram exists, first create one before attempting to construct the level 1 dfd or construct the context diagram and level 1 dfd simultaneously. Data flow diagram tutorial after completion of study of. It is usually beginning with a context diagram as level 0 of the dfd diagram, a simple representation of.
To create new dfd, select diagram new from the toolbar. You can edit this data flow diagram using creately diagramming tool and include in your reportpresentationwebsite. Exercise context diagram of a possible project what project would you like to work on this quarter. Levels in data flow diagrams dfd in software engineering dfd data flow diagram can be drawn to represent the system of different levels of abstraction. This sample is given by the press production process, which being a physical entity is not shown on the dfd.
First level data flow diagram 1st level dfd of hospital management system. Library management system free download as word doc. Higher level dfds are partitioned into low levelshacking more information and functional elements. Data flow diagrams dfd context and first level dfd for. Context and first level dfd for hotel booking system. Problems and exercises solutions azsmarttech services. In this diagram, a single process represents the whole system. If you continue browsing the site, you agree to the use of cookies on this website. Use pdf export for high quality prints and svg export for large sharp images or embed your diagrams anywhere with the creately viewer. Lets expand process order to elaborate on the logical functions of the system. Data flow diagram everything you need to know about dfd. Level 1 dataflow diagrams department of computer science.
It can be manual, automated, or a combination of both. Level 1 the level 0 dfd is broken down into more specific, level 1 dfd. The necessary level of detail depends on the scope of what you are trying to accomplish. Library management system dataflow diagram dfd freeprojectz. An example of the development of a data flow diagram 6. A dataflow diagram has no control flow, there are no decision rules and no loops. Level 1 data flow model diagram example in pdf with an explanation.
Secretary of state web site development projectyou have been tasked with developing the software for the michigan secretary of state. A sample of the order placed by the department is first prepared for verification and sent to the department by the order registration process. During a call the customers details name, address etc. The user is all people who operate or visit our website. The main aim of providing online shopping project dfd data flow diagrams is to explain how design phases important in sdlc process while developing any web application software project. Scenario consider a garment system where foreign buyer gives some order to the garment. View and share this diagram and more in your device or register via your computer. The o level dfd describe the all user modules who run the system.
219 422 1209 1210 731 818 239 590 211 422 910 974 1254 555 1160 165 1109 390 792 129 659 75 205 1012 362 737 1528 520 886 390 1430 762 444 1526 843 1366 354 292 141 727 489 44 952 840 1491 321